What is AI workflow coaching?
AI workflow coaching is hands-on support built around a real recurring task, such as a report, meeting, project update, analysis, or decision. The work maps the inputs, human judgment, AI contribution, output, verification, and guardrails so the result can be used again.
Who is this coaching for?
It is designed for managers, directors, executives, project leaders, and operations or supply chain teams that already have access to an approved AI tool but are not yet turning it into dependable ways of working.
Which AI tools can we use?
The coaching is tool-agnostic and can work with approved tools such as Microsoft Copilot, ChatGPT, Claude, or Gemini. The choice depends on your organization's access, data rules, and the workflow being improved.
Do I need a technical background?
No. The work is designed for business leaders and professionals. The focus is defining the work, improving the output, and using sound review habits rather than understanding model architecture or writing code.
Is it safe to use AI with work information?
It can be when the tool and information are approved by your organization. Coaching includes practical data boundaries, privacy checks, source verification, and human review. Formal legal, compliance, governance, and security decisions remain with your organization's authorized teams.
What happens in a working session?
You bring one recurring task and relevant public-safe or approved material. Together we map the workflow, choose the appropriate AI contribution, test a practical version, define verification and privacy checks, and document a playbook you can reuse.
What will I leave with?
You will leave with a tested workflow, reusable prompts or instructions, a review checklist, practical guardrails, and a clear next iteration. The exact deliverable depends on the task and approved tools.
How much does AI workflow coaching cost?
The AI Workflow Working Session is $395 at the current launch price. The three-session Manager AI Sprint is $1,250. Team workshops and ongoing adoption support are quoted after a fit conversation because scope and audience vary.
When is this not a good fit?
It is not yet a good fit when no AI tool is approved, data boundaries are unclear, no one can own the final review, or the goal is to hand high-stakes professional decisions to AI. It is also not the right service for a generic keynote, software implementation, or unsupervised automation project.
